Pretty much what Guppy said. It's a little different in all states, but it's usually used as a way to expose students in their first year of high school to all areas of social science, before they decide what subjects to focus on in their senior years.

Bruce Schneier runs a yearly design a terrorism scenario contest. Got an idea? save it for then. Some of them are pretty inventive.
